Chennai-Mysore-Chennai Shatabdi Express gets IMS certification

Chennai-Mysore-Chennai Shatabdi Express gets IMS certification

The Chennai-Mysore-Chennai Shatabdi Express has become the first Integrated Management Systems (IMS) certified train of Southern Railway. It has also become the first Shatabdi train and second mail/express train of Indian Railways to receive the IMS certification. India’s First Unique Manned Ocean Mission Samudrayan at Chennai launched

India’s First Unique Manned Ocean Mission Samudrayan at Chennai launched

Union Minister Jitendra Singh has launched India’s First Manned Ocean Mission Samudrayan at Chennai. With this, India joins the elite club of nations such as the USA, Russia, Japan, France, and China to have such underwater vehicles for carrying out subsea activities. Centre to set up two container-based mobile hospitals with 100 beds in Delhi and Chennai

Centre to set up two container-based mobile hospitals with 100 beds in Delhi and Chennai

India is gearing up to ready two container-based mobile hospitals for emergency deployment in cases of natural or other calamities, as part of the Rs 64,000 crore, Prime Minister Ayushman Bharat Health Infrastructure Mission unveiled by PM Narendra Modi.
